Action of enzymes 0.0 / 5 ? BiologyEnzymesASOCR Created by: JemmaVenessCreated on: 19-05-16 15:06 What are enzymes? Biological Catalysts 1 of 6 What can they do in the body? Speed up chemical reactions by acting as biological catalysts 2 of 6 What are the two types of enzymes? Intracellular, Extracellular enzymes 3 of 6 Describe enzymes Globular proteins, Enzymes are highly selective catalysts, meaning that each enzyme only speeds up a specific reaction 4 of 6 Explain the lock and key model The substrate fits into the enzyme like how a key fits into a lock 5 of 6 Explain the 'induced fit' model As the substrate binds, the active site changed shape slightly to fit the substrate more closely. 6 of 6
